Walkthrough
  1. 1
    BLK A-01: Start by dealing with Crows. Head down the stairs, collecting an Axe from a Red Whip Skeleton. Navigate a downward auto-scroller, prioritizing landing on the gear to avoid instant death. Jump between gears, avoiding Medusa Heads. Drop left, wait for the screen to scroll, then drop right and left. A gear on the left is your goal. In the next screen, descend stairs cautiously, waiting for a Bone Pillar's shots to pass before attacking. Collect Hearts, but be aware the ground crumbles as you head left. Deal with a second Bone Pillar quickly using sub-weapons due to falling blocks.
  2. 2
    BLK A-02: Encounter Spiders on the right; defeat them before dropping to kill a Whip Skeleton. Collect Sacred Water and Leg of Werewolf. Head left, defeating a Red Skeleton and dodging bone attacks. Grab an Axe from an upper right candle, useful for the boss. Ascend to the next screen. This section requires jumping between three pendulums while dodging constant Bats. The jump from the second to the third pendulum requires careful timing to avoid overshooting. Watch for Bats near the final door.
  3. 3
    BLK A-03: This block primarily consists of candles leading to Dracula. One candle near the end contains a Dagger.

BOSS: Dracula

Strategy:

  • Phase 1: Dracula stands and creates flames around you, including a persistent third flame that sprouts from below. He teleports and repeats. Stay at maximum range, ideally with a long-range sub-weapon. Position yourself in the area with the most room and quickly move out of the way of the third flame. Aim for his head.
  • Phase 2: Dracula loses his head and transforms into a multi-headed creature that floats and drips projectiles. Avoid the projectiles and try to stay underneath him. The Axe and Banshee Boomerang are effective here. Use sub-weapons like the Axe, especially if you have Double or Triple Trouble icons.
Tips
  • The initial auto-scroller in BLK A-01 has a cheap instant death mechanic if you miss the first gear.
  • Medusa Heads are a persistent threat during the auto-scroller descent.
  • The crumbling ground in BLK A-01 requires quick movement.
  • Using sub-weapons is crucial for quickly defeating the Bone Pillars.
  • The pendulum section in BLK A-02 is challenging due to Bats and precise jumping.
  • The Axe sub-weapon is highly recommended for the final boss fight, especially against Dracula's second phase.
  • Dying before Dracula respawns you at the start of BLK A-03, allowing you to collect candles again, but you may lose a valuable sub-weapon.
